Azimuthal anisotropy of Υ(1S) mesons in pPb collisions at sNN= 8.16 TeV
Abstract: The azimuthal anisotropy of Υ(1S) mesons in high-multiplicity proton-lead (pPb) collisions is studied using data collected by the CMS experiment at a center-of-mass energy per nucleon pair of sNN= 8.16 TeV. The Υ(1S) mesons are reconstructed from the dimuon decay channel. The anisotropy, characterized by the second Fourier harmonic v2 coefficient, is determined using the two-particle correlation technique, where the Υ(1S) mesons are correlated with charged hadrons. A large pseudorapidity gap is used to suppress short-range correlations. The v2 values are measured in four transverse momentum intervals in the range from 0 to 30 GeV/c. No azimuthal anisotropy is observed for the Υ(1S) mesons in high-multiplicity pPb collisions, which is consistent with previous lead-lead collision results.
